Comfort
The most luxurious leather sofas offer the most comfort, based on the type and quality of the leather and the construction of the frame and cushions. The kind of suspension used to support the weight is another crucial aspect. Hand tied springs that are 8-way are considered the best. If the frame is constructed of wood, look for kiln dried hardwoods instead of plywood or MDF that are less durable.
Cushioning is a crucial factor in the comfort level of a leather couch. Cushions that sink in and are supportive provide different levels of comfort. Wellington's suggests choosing an item with removable cushions, so you can replace them when they get worn out. This lets you alter the level of comfort that you are able to enjoy.

When selecting a sofa made of leather it is important to consider the type of leather and the construction.
The ideal is to make your leather sofa from top grain or full grain leather. These kinds of leathers will last a long time and are considered to be the best quality. They are also easy to clean, which makes them a great choice for households with pets or children.
It is also hypoallergenic, which makes it an ideal choice for homes that have sensitivities or allergies. It is also resistant against heat and fire. You can relax in the fireplace without worrying about your sofa melting or catching fire.
A quality leather sofa will have a sturdy frame and high-density foam and down-wrapped cushions. It should also feature a solid suspension system, like sinuous springs or eight-way hand-tied coils. This will prevent sagging over time and ensure the comfort of your seat.
When buying a leather sofa, be certain to avoid bonded or gel leather, which isn't real leather and will not last as long. These sofas are often cheaper, but they will crack, flake, or peel over time. Find genuine leather with natural, textured look and has a pleasant smell.
